The Cost Journey: From Factory to Store

Firstly, let's address the elephant in the room - leather and fur products often undergo significant price hikes as they traverse from the factory floor to high-end retlers. When a merchant chooses to outsource goods like leather or furs for manufacture, the initial cost is relatively low compared to what you might see on retl racks.

For example, consider an average leather coat that costs just a few hundred dollars to produce and ship out of a workshop. The manufacturing process may be streamlined with economies of scale when volume production occurs – this often results in lower unit costs than many would expect.

However, once these goods hit the market through retlers specializing in high-end fashion items, prices can escalate dramatically. This transformation from wholesale to retl typically sees prices multiply by several times their original cost. For a leather coat initially priced around $200-$300 at manufacturing level, you might stumble upon it as a premium item with price tags soaring up to five times this amount or even more.

The Role of Luxury Branding

So, what drives these significant mark-ups? The answer lies largely in branding and marketing efforts. Luxury fashion brands invest heavily into building brand reputation, creating exquisite designs that appeal to consumers' aspirations for prestige and exclusivity. These factors combine to elevate the perceived value of a product significantly.
